To determine the scale factor used in the dilation of the larger rectangle to the similar smaller rectangle, we can compare the corresponding sides of the two rectangles.

Let's say the corresponding side lengths of the larger rectangle to the smaller rectangle are:
- Larger rectangle: Length = L, Width = W
- Smaller rectangle: Length = L/2, Width = W/2

To find the scale factor, we can take the ratio of the length of the larger rectangle to the corresponding length of the smaller rectangle:

Scale Factor = (Length of Larger Rectangle) / (Length of Smaller Rectangle)
Scale Factor = L / (L/2) = 2

Therefore, the scale factor used in the dilation of the larger rectangle to the similar smaller rectangle is 2.
